Illustrious action with France

HMS IllustriousPortsmouth-based warship HMS Illustrious is to go on a major naval exercise with the French navy later this year, The News can reveal.

Sources have confirmed the navy’s on-call helicopter carrier – which is at 48 hours’ notice to sail anywhere in the world – will join France’s nuclear-powered Charles de Gaulle aircraft carrier in the Mediterranean in October for a series of war game exercises to build on the UK’s military pact with France.

Lusty, which has returned to front-line duties following a £40m refit, will be joined by HMS Ocean and a number of Royal Navy frigates and destroyers as part of the navy’s roving Response Force Task Group (RFTG).
